Axonally transported proteins associated with axon growth in rabbit central and peripheral nervous systems
In an effort to determine whether the “growth state” and the “mature state” of a neuron are differentiated by different programs of gene expression, we have compared the rapidly transported (group I) proteins in growing and nongrowing axons in rabbits.
